Signs By Tomorrow Names Ray Palmer President

Former franchisee owned and operated four Maryland locations.

Signs By Tomorrow (Columbia, MD) has appointed Maryland native Ramon “Ray” L. Palmer as new president effective Monday, November 29, 2010.
As president, CEO and co-founder of Palmer Vohrer Enterprises, Palmer has been involved with Signs By Tomorrow for the past 10 years as a franchisee, having owned and operated four of the national chain’s Maryland locations. Palmer also served as a member and chairperson of Signs By Tomorrow’s Franchise Advisory Council, on which he played a key role in developing the firm’s national website and establishing a franchisee advertising fund.
Palmer succeeds Joseph McGuinness, who has held the position of president since founding the company in 1986. McGuinness will stay on as chairman of the board and founder for Signs By Tomorrow USA, assisting with the leadership transition and focusing on franchise sales.
McGuinness said, “With his excellent educational and corporate background and firsthand experience as a franchisee, Ray is a natural choice to succeed me as president. Having lived the role of a franchisee and as an actively involved key team member, Ray has invaluable experience that positions him to take Signs By Tomorrow into the future and stand ready to serve the next generation as we prepare to celebrate our 25th anniversary next year.”
Palmer foresees strong growth: “My history as a multi-store owner and consultant to the franchisor provides a unique perspective on our customer needs, which drives the growth of our great company. Continued focus on franchisee relationships, increased brand synergy and technological advancements will fuel our future market strategy and strengthen the technical expertise we now enjoy in our industry. I am proud to lead and continue to grow our strong network of franchisees.”
Prior to founding Palmer Vohrer Enterprises in 2001, Palmer worked for other area businesses over his 27-year career, including Cambridge Positioning Systems, Advanced Wireless Technologies, Communications Electronics, Genesis Data Systems and AAI Corporation.
Palmer holds an undergraduate degree in electrical engineering and a master’s degree in business from the Johns Hopkins University. He currently resides in Phoenix, MD, where he is a member of the board of directors for the Baltimore Area Council of Boy Scouts of America.
